When trees are compared to persons in literary texts, the purpose is often to create a metaphor for human qualities. This use of personification, a form of metaphor, imbues the trees with characteristics and qualities that are typically associated with people. Such a comparison serves to bring the natural world closer to the human experience, making it more relatable and easier to empathize with. Moreover, it often highlights the psychological and moral value of trees and nature, suggesting that humans and nature are closely connected and that the natural world has an intrinsic value worthy of respect and preservation.
